These days, finding an affordable place to live in the Coppell area can be challenging. Home prices in Coppell are now at a median cost of $432,387, higher than the Texas average of $235,268.
The average cost of rent is $1,695/mo in Coppell, primarily driven by the current value of real estate in the Coppell area. While nearly 35.25% of residents own their homes outright in Coppell, 30.47% rent.
Housing affordability isn’t just about home prices, though. The average household income in Coppell is $10,224 per month. Households that rent pay about 16.58% of their income on rent here. Coppell's most expensive areas are in the northeastern regions, while the cheapest areas are in the southern parts of the city.
